My Buying Guides on Jeep Gladiator Bed Rack With Tonneau Cover

When I started looking for a Jeep Gladiator bed rack with tonneau cover, I quickly realized that not every rack and cover combination works well together. I wanted something that would let me haul gear securely, keep my bed protected, and still give me easy access when I needed it. After comparing different setups, I learned that the best choice depends on how I use my Gladiator, what kind of tonneau cover I already have or want, and how much weight I plan to carry.

1. I Start by Checking Compatibility

The first thing I always look at is whether the bed rack is actually designed to work with a tonneau cover. Some racks mount in a way that blocks the cover rails, while others are built specifically for low-profile or hard-folding tonneau covers. I make sure the rack and cover can coexist without interfering with each other’s operation.

2. I Decide What Type of Tonneau Cover I Want

My next step is choosing the right tonneau cover style. Soft roll-up covers are usually more flexible, but hard folding or retractable covers often give me better security and a cleaner setup. Since the bed rack sits above or around the cover, I want a tonneau that opens and closes smoothly even with the rack installed.

3. I Look at Rack Height and Bed Clearance

Rack height matters more than I expected. If the rack is too tall, it can affect my truck’s aerodynamics and garage clearance. If it is too low, I may not have enough room for larger cargo or rooftop accessories. I usually look for a height that gives me enough space for storage bins, camping gear, or a rooftop tent without making the truck awkward to use.

4. I Check the Weight Capacity

For me, weight capacity is a big deal. I want to know how much static and dynamic load the rack can handle. Static load matters if I plan to mount a rooftop tent, while dynamic load is important for driving with gear on top. I always compare the rack’s rating with the weight of the items I plan to carry so I do not overload it.

5. I Pay Attention to Material and Build Quality

I prefer racks made from strong materials like steel or aluminum, depending on whether I want maximum durability or lighter weight. Powder-coated finishes are important to me because they help resist rust and wear, especially if I drive in rain, snow, or off-road conditions. I also check welds, brackets, and hardware quality because those details tell me a lot about long-term reliability.

6. I Think About Access to the Bed

One thing I did not want was a setup that made my truck bed hard to use. I look for a rack that still allows me to open the tonneau cover fully or partially without removing the rack. If I often load tools, camping gear, or sports equipment, easy bed access becomes a major factor in my decision.

7. I Consider My Intended Use

I ask myself how I will really use the rack. If I am building an overlanding setup, I need something strong enough for a tent, recovery gear, and accessories. If I just want extra cargo space for weekend trips, I may not need the most heavy-duty option. Knowing my use case helps me avoid paying for features I will never use.

8. I Look for Easy Installation

I prefer a rack that installs without major modifications to my Gladiator. Some systems are bolt-on and straightforward, while others require more time and tools. I also like clear instructions and good customer support because that makes the whole process less stressful. If I can install it myself in a few hours, that is usually a big plus.

9. I Check for Compatibility With Accessories

Another thing I think about is whether I can add accessories later. I like racks that support mounts for awnings, recovery boards, fuel cans, traction gear, lights, or rooftop tents. A modular system gives me more flexibility, so I can build out my Gladiator over time instead of replacing the whole setup later.

10. I Compare Price Against Value

I do not always go for the cheapest option. Instead, I look for the best value. A slightly more expensive rack may be worth it if it offers better compatibility, stronger construction, and a better finish. I try to balance budget with long-term use because a good rack and tonneau cover combo should last me for years.
